The Role of Protein in Longevity Protein is more than a muscle nutrient â itâs a marker of aging and resilience. Higher lean body mass predicts lower risk of cardiovascular disease, dementia, and all-cause mortality. Your body replaces roughly 250â300 grams of protein daily through constant turnover. Without enough dietary intake and resistance training, that process breaks down, leading to loss of function and vitality over time. Why the RDA Is Outdated That familiar 0.8 g/kg recommendation? It was based on old data aimed at preventing malnutrition, not optimizing health. Most adults need closer to 1â1.6 g/kg, or roughly 1 gram per pound of ideal body weight. Too many adults over 40 barely hit the minimum, leading to preventable loss of lean mass, slower metabolism, and higher visceral fat. Aging isnât the only culprit â under-protein-ing and under-movement are. Protein and Metabolism Protein burns more calories to digest than carbs or fats, and muscle acts as a glucose sponge, stabilizing blood sugar and reducing inflammation. It also improves satiety by regulating hunger hormones, so before you reach for appetite suppressants, check your plate â protein first makes a big difference. Plant vs. Animal Protein Animal proteins contain all nine essential amino acids, especially leucine, which triggers muscle protein synthesis. Plant-based diets can work beautifully too â they just require more planning and variety. Combine lentils with quinoa, beans with rice, or tofu with edamame to get a complete amino acid profile. A âclimate-conscious omnivoreâ approach can balance health, ethics, and sustainability. Myth Busting High protein doesnât damage kidneys in healthy individuals. You can absorb more than 30 grams per meal â that number just refers to the amount that maximally stimulates muscle building. And no, protein wonât make you bulky â youâd need years of heavy training for that. Protein Timing and Real-World Tips Consistency matters more than timing. Hitting your daily protein goal within 24 hours of a workout is what counts â not whether you drink a shake within an hour. Whey protein powder might be technically âultra-processed,â but itâs a functional one â a tool to help you meet your goals efficiently. Real Talk: Balance and Longevity Most adults under-eat protein and overeat processed carbs. The result is fatigue, poor recovery, more visceral fat, and faster muscle loss. Focus on building your plate intentionally â start with a palm-sized portion of protein, then veggies, then carbs. For those in their 40s and beyond, this is especially crucial. Older adults need more protein, not less, to offset anabolic resistance. For women, especially post-menopause, adequate protein supports bone density, muscle retention, and metabolic health. Practical Takeaways Aim for around 1 gram of protein per pound of ideal body weight. Distribute it evenly across your meals â 30 to 40 grams each. Pair it with regular resistance training for the biggest payoff. Choose quality over perfection â whole foods first, supplements as needed. Longevity is about progress, not perfection. đĄ Episode Overview In this no-BS crash course, the doctors cover testosterone. Testosterone is one of the most misunderstood and overhyped hormones in medicine today. Often labeled as a âmale hormone,â testosterone actually plays a critical role in both men and womenâimpacting energy, mood, cognition, bone density, muscle mass, and metabolic health. Despite its importance, research shows a concerning trend: average testosterone levels have declined by 20â25% over the past few decades, even after adjusting for age. A man in his 40s today typically has the testosterone levels of a man in his 30s a generation ago. This generational drop is not simply a reflection of aging but a sign of broader environmental and lifestyle influences. Chronic stress, poor sleep, rising obesity rates, sedentary behavior, and widespread exposure to endocrine disruptors such as BPA and pesticides all contribute to suppressed hormone production and disrupted balance. They discuss the physiology of testosterone, common symptoms of deficiency, and why so many people are being overdiagnosed or overtreated through aggressive testosterone replacement therapy (TRT) without proper evaluation. Many commercial âLow Tâ clinics skip essential lab work and fail to address the underlying causes of hormonal decline. This approach not only risks suppressing the bodyâs own testosterone production but can also lead to long-term dependency, infertility, and cardiovascular complications. The episode emphasizes that sustainable optimization starts with addressing foundational health behaviorsâimproving sleep quality, reducing visceral fat, managing stress, engaging in resistance and high-intensity interval training, ensuring adequate protein and micronutrient intake, and minimizing alcohol and environmental toxins. Dr. Nisha and Dr. Vikas also share a real-life case study of a 45-year-old father who arrived at their clinic exhausted and convinced he needed lifelong TRT. Instead, through a structured plan focusing on exercise, nutrition, and recovery, his testosterone increased naturally from the low 300s to the mid-500s ng/dLâwithout injections or medication. This story illustrates that low testosterone is often a reflection of lifestyle dysfunction, not irreversible endocrine failure. Key Topics Covered The Scope of the Problem: Nearly 50% of American adults are affected by diabetes or pre-diabetes, yet 80% of pre-diabetics donât even know it. The Hidden Costs: Diabetes costs the U.S. economy an estimated $327 billion annually in healthcare spending and lost productivity. Biological Mechanisms: High glucose levels drive glycation, which damages blood vessels and accelerates aging. Long-Term Risks: Diabetes increases the risk of dementia by 60â70%, along with higher rates of cardiovascular disease, kidney disease, and blindness. Prevention Works: Lifestyle changesâsuch as diet improvements and exerciseâcan reduce diabetes risk by 58%. Nutrition Insights: Adequate protein intake is critical for stabilizing blood sugar and preserving muscle mass. Exercise & Insulin Sensitivity: Strength training and regular activity improve glucose uptake and metabolic flexibility. Technology in Action: Continuous glucose monitors (CGMs) offer real-time feedback, empowering smarter food and lifestyle decisions. Therapeutic Support: Medications like metformin and GLP-1 receptor agonists play an important role for certain patients. Key Takeaways Diabetes is widespread but often undiagnosed.
